The legendary Spinal Tap amps now go beyond 11!
The highly anticipated sequel, Spinal Tap II, to the iconic 1984 rock mockumentary This is Spinal Tap, is officially set to premiere on September 12. Fans of the original will be thrilled to see how the band evolves in this new chapter.
Bleecker Street is taking on the U.S. distribution for this exciting new film, ensuring it reaches audiences nationwide.
A sneak peek teaser for the movie, embedded below, showcases the band gearing up for a live performance, humorously revealing an amplifier volume knob that now surpasses “11,” extending into… infinity.
Original members David St. Hubbins (played by Michael McKean), Nigel Tufnel (Christopher Guest), and Derek Smalls (Harry Shearer) are confirmed to return for this new installment. Joining them are legendary rock icons Paul McCartney and Elton John, adding even more star power to the film.
Returning cast members also include Paul Shaffer as Artie Fufkin and Fran Drescher as Bobbi Flekman, promising to deliver nostalgic laughs. Fans can also anticipate the return of one or more unfortunate drummers who are likely to meet their comedic fate.

In December, director and co-writer Rob Reiner shared that Spinal Tap II will depict the once-retired band unexpectedly reuniting after finding themselves back in the limelight. “A major music star, during a sound check, accidentally records themselves singing a Spinal Tap song on an iPhone,” he revealed to Empire. “This footage goes viral on social media, reigniting their fame.”
Audiences can also look forward to new music from Spinal Tap. “There will be a couple of tracks featuring Elton John and one from Paul McCartney—songs they perform in the film that aren’t typical of Spinal Tap but are well-known,” he added. “The remainder will be all-new material from the band.”
Additionally, fans should stay tuned for a nationwide re-release of the original This Is Spinal Tap movie, set to hit theaters this summer, with more details to follow soon.
